Full Data Comparison
| Metric | Austin, TX | Elizabeth, NJ |
|---|---|---|
| 💰 Cost of Living | ||
| Cost of Living Index National avg = 100 · lower = cheaper | 97.6 ✓ Cheaper | 112.5⚠ High |
| Median Home Value | $461,500⚠ High | $358,400⚠ High ✓ Lower |
| Median Monthly Rent | $1,549⚠ High | $1,390⚠ High ✓ Lower |
| 📈 Income & Economy | ||
| Median Household Income | $86,556 ✓ Higher | $59,939 |
| Unemployment Rate | 4.4%⚠ High ✓ Lower | 5.9%⚠ High |
| Avg Commute Minutes each way | 24.1 min ✓ Shorter | 26.7 min |
| Work From Home % | 22.9% ✓ Higher | 4.8% |
| 🔒 Safety | ||
|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er · 60% violent / 40% property | 135⚠ High | 115⚠ High ✓ Safer |
| Violent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er | 123⚠ High | 108⚠ High ✓ Safer |
| Property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er | 154⚠ High | 127⚠ High ✓ Safer |
| 🎓 Education | ||
| School Quality 100 = national avg · grad rate, staffing & attainment | A+ (133) ✓ Better | B- (91) |
| Student-Teacher Ratio Lower = smaller classes | 14.0:1 | 13.0:1 ✓ Smaller |
| Bachelor's Degree or Higher | 56.5% ✓ Higher | 14.1% |
| High School or Higher | 91.1% ✓ Higher | 74.3% |
| School District Name only — no quality rating available | AUSTIN ISD | Elizabeth Public Schools |
| 🌤 Weather | ||
| Avg High — January | 62.5°F ✓ Warmer | 40.0°F |
| Avg High — July | 96.6°F ✓ Warmer | 86.9°F |
| Annual Precipitation | 36.2" ✓ Drier | 46.6" |
| Annual Snowfall | 0.2" ✓ Less | 31.5" |
| 👥 Demographics | ||
| Population | 958,202 ✓ Larger | 135,665 |
| Median Age | 34.2 | 35.7 ✓ Older |
| Homeownership Rate | 44.4% ✓ Higher | 25.1% |
| Under 18 | 18.7% | 25.4% ✓ More |
| Over 65 | 9.8% | 11.4% ✓ More |
